DBA Data[Home] [Help]

APPS.AR_INTEREST_LINES_PKG dependencies on AR_INTEREST_LINES

Line 1: PACKAGE BODY AR_INTEREST_LINES_PKG AS

1: PACKAGE BODY AR_INTEREST_LINES_PKG AS
2: /*$Header: ARIILINEB.pls 120.1 2006/03/09 22:54:30 hyu noship $*/
3:
4: PROCEDURE Lock_line
5: (P_INTEREST_LINE_ID IN NUMBER,

Line 42: FROM AR_INTEREST_LINES

38: x_msg_data OUT NOCOPY VARCHAR2)
39: IS
40: CURSOR C IS
41: SELECT *
42: FROM AR_INTEREST_LINES
43: WHERE interest_line_id = p_interest_line_id
44: FOR UPDATE of Interest_Line_Id NOWAIT;
45: Recinfo C%ROWTYPE;
46: BEGIN

Line 108: p_old_rec IN ar_interest_lines%ROWTYPE,

104: END Lock_line;
105:
106: PROCEDURE validate_line
107: (p_action IN VARCHAR2,
108: p_old_rec IN ar_interest_lines%ROWTYPE,
109: p_new_rec IN ar_interest_lines%ROWTYPE,
110: x_return_status IN OUT NOCOPY VARCHAR2)
111: IS
112: CURSOR c IS

Line 109: p_new_rec IN ar_interest_lines%ROWTYPE,

105:
106: PROCEDURE validate_line
107: (p_action IN VARCHAR2,
108: p_old_rec IN ar_interest_lines%ROWTYPE,
109: p_new_rec IN ar_interest_lines%ROWTYPE,
110: x_return_status IN OUT NOCOPY VARCHAR2)
111: IS
112: CURSOR c IS
113: SELECT process_status

Line 172: FROM ar_interest_lines

168: x_msg_data OUT NOCOPY VARCHAR2)
169: IS
170: CURSOR c IS
171: SELECT *
172: FROM ar_interest_lines
173: WHERE interest_line_id = P_INTEREST_line_ID
174: FOR UPDATE OF INTEREST_line_ID;
175: l_rec ar_interest_lines%ROWTYPE;
176: l_new_rec ar_interest_lines%ROWTYPE;

Line 175: l_rec ar_interest_lines%ROWTYPE;

171: SELECT *
172: FROM ar_interest_lines
173: WHERE interest_line_id = P_INTEREST_line_ID
174: FOR UPDATE OF INTEREST_line_ID;
175: l_rec ar_interest_lines%ROWTYPE;
176: l_new_rec ar_interest_lines%ROWTYPE;
177: BEGIN
178: arp_util.debug('AR_INTEREST_BATCHES_PKG.update_line +');
179: arp_util.debug(' p_interest_line_id :' ||P_INTEREST_LINE_ID);

Line 176: l_new_rec ar_interest_lines%ROWTYPE;

172: FROM ar_interest_lines
173: WHERE interest_line_id = P_INTEREST_line_ID
174: FOR UPDATE OF INTEREST_line_ID;
175: l_rec ar_interest_lines%ROWTYPE;
176: l_new_rec ar_interest_lines%ROWTYPE;
177: BEGIN
178: arp_util.debug('AR_INTEREST_BATCHES_PKG.update_line +');
179: arp_util.debug(' p_interest_line_id :' ||P_INTEREST_LINE_ID);
180: SAVEPOINT Update_line;

Line 195: fnd_message.set_token('RECORD', 'ar_interest_lines');

191: CLOSE c;
192:
193: IF l_rec.INTEREST_line_ID IS NULL THEN
194: fnd_message.set_name('AR', 'HZ_API_NO_RECORD');
195: fnd_message.set_token('RECORD', 'ar_interest_lines');
196: fnd_message.set_token('VALUE',
197: NVL(TO_CHAR(P_INTEREST_line_ID), 'null'));
198: fnd_msg_pub.add;
199: RAISE fnd_api.g_exc_error;

Line 209: fnd_message.set_token('TABLE', 'ar_interest_lines');

205: l_rec.OBJECT_VERSION_NUMBER IS NOT NULL AND
206: x_object_version_number = l_rec.OBJECT_VERSION_NUMBER))
207: THEN
208: fnd_message.set_name('AR', 'HZ_API_RECORD_CHANGED');
209: fnd_message.set_token('TABLE', 'ar_interest_lines');
210: fnd_msg_pub.add;
211: RAISE fnd_api.g_exc_error;
212: END IF;
213:

Line 229: arp_util.debug(' updating ar_interest_lines');

225: END IF;
226:
227: x_object_version_number := NVL(x_object_version_number,1) + 1;
228:
229: arp_util.debug(' updating ar_interest_lines');
230: UPDATE AR_INTEREST_LINES
231: SET
232: LAST_UPDATE_DATE = SYSDATE,
233: LAST_UPDATED_BY = NVL(arp_global.last_updated_by,-1),

Line 230: UPDATE AR_INTEREST_LINES

226:
227: x_object_version_number := NVL(x_object_version_number,1) + 1;
228:
229: arp_util.debug(' updating ar_interest_lines');
230: UPDATE AR_INTEREST_LINES
231: SET
232: LAST_UPDATE_DATE = SYSDATE,
233: LAST_UPDATED_BY = NVL(arp_global.last_updated_by,-1),
234: LAST_UPDATE_LOGIN = NVL(arp_global.LAST_UPDATE_LOGIN,-1),

Line 273: FROM ar_interest_lines

269: x_msg_data OUT NOCOPY VARCHAR2)
270: IS
271: CURSOR c IS
272: SELECT *
273: FROM ar_interest_lines
274: WHERE interest_line_id = P_INTEREST_line_ID
275: FOR UPDATE OF INTEREST_line_ID;
276: l_rec ar_interest_lines%ROWTYPE;
277: l_new_rec ar_interest_lines%ROWTYPE;

Line 276: l_rec ar_interest_lines%ROWTYPE;

272: SELECT *
273: FROM ar_interest_lines
274: WHERE interest_line_id = P_INTEREST_line_ID
275: FOR UPDATE OF INTEREST_line_ID;
276: l_rec ar_interest_lines%ROWTYPE;
277: l_new_rec ar_interest_lines%ROWTYPE;
278: BEGIN
279: arp_util.debug('AR_INTEREST_BATCHES_PKG.delete_line +');
280: SAVEPOINT Delete_line;

Line 277: l_new_rec ar_interest_lines%ROWTYPE;

273: FROM ar_interest_lines
274: WHERE interest_line_id = P_INTEREST_line_ID
275: FOR UPDATE OF INTEREST_line_ID;
276: l_rec ar_interest_lines%ROWTYPE;
277: l_new_rec ar_interest_lines%ROWTYPE;
278: BEGIN
279: arp_util.debug('AR_INTEREST_BATCHES_PKG.delete_line +');
280: SAVEPOINT Delete_line;
281: x_return_status := fnd_api.g_ret_sts_success;

Line 295: fnd_message.set_token('RECORD', 'ar_interest_lines');

291: CLOSE c;
292:
293: IF l_rec.INTEREST_line_ID IS NULL THEN
294: fnd_message.set_name('AR', 'HZ_API_NO_RECORD');
295: fnd_message.set_token('RECORD', 'ar_interest_lines');
296: fnd_message.set_token('VALUE',
297: NVL(TO_CHAR(P_INTEREST_line_ID), 'null'));
298: fnd_msg_pub.add;
299: RAISE fnd_api.g_exc_error;

Line 309: fnd_message.set_token('TABLE', 'ar_interest_lines');

305: l_rec.OBJECT_VERSION_NUMBER IS NOT NULL AND
306: x_object_version_number = l_rec.OBJECT_VERSION_NUMBER))
307: THEN
308: fnd_message.set_name('AR', 'HZ_API_RECORD_CHANGED');
309: fnd_message.set_token('TABLE', 'ar_interest_lines');
310: fnd_msg_pub.add;
311: RAISE fnd_api.g_exc_error;
312: END IF;
313:

Line 324: DELETE FROM AR_INTEREST_LINES

320: IF x_return_status <> fnd_api.g_ret_sts_success THEN
321: RAISE fnd_api.g_exc_error;
322: END IF;
323:
324: DELETE FROM AR_INTEREST_LINES
325: WHERE interest_line_id = p_interest_line_id;
326:
327: arp_util.debug('AR_INTEREST_BATCHES_PKG.delete_line -');
328: EXCEPTION

Line 350: END AR_INTEREST_LINES_PKG;

346:
347: END Delete_line;
348:
349:
350: END AR_INTEREST_LINES_PKG;